Thunderstorms moved northward from Iowa into southern Minnesota in the mid- afternoon on May 21st. One tornado touched down briefly near Fairmont in Martin County. Another potential tornado touched down near Mapleton in Blue Earth County. A brief tornado occurred just west of Red Wing as this line continued to the northeast. This thunderstorm complex develop and moved rapidly across southern Minnesota and into Western Wisconsin, where one more tornado touched down to the east of Eau Claire near Augusta and tracked about 10 miles to the north.
